McKeown breaks 200m backstroke world record
Australian Kaylee McKeown broke the women's 200 metres backstroke world record at the New South Wales State Open Championships in Sydney on Friday.

After Team India's Holi celebration videos created a storm on social media, a series of pictures -- showing the Australian team enjoying the festival of colours -- has now created a new buzz among the fans. Australia registered a comfortable nine-wicket win over India in the third Test of the Border-Gavasakar Trophy in Indore. With this win, the visitors also entered the World Test Championship final. As both the teams are now gearing up for the fourth Test, which will begin from Thursday in Ahmedabad, the Steve Smith-led side took some time off and celebrated Holi on Wednesday.
